A week ago I had the pleasure to again spend a few days with Blancpain and the brand ambassador Chef Holger Bodendorf for the 20th Sylt Gourmet Festival.

Holger Bodendorfโs Landhaus Stricker has again been partly transformed into a showroom with not only a plentiful of exciting Blancpain timepieces displayed, but also providing a watchmakers workbench with the Blancpain Germany Atelier manager being present to answer any technical questions or even do some small adjustments on watches of the guests.






The Sylt Gourmet Festival has a tradition of bringing Chefs from all over the world to accompany the local masters. This year the guest Chefs came from Mexico, Oman, the Maledives, India and Spain. On an all day Safari the guests visited 5 different restaurants, each offering sensational food and excellent wines. To get around two historic Magirus busses provided travel in style, and the islands nature offered a fantastic scenery.
